摘要
The effects of thermal radiation on free convection in a non-Newtonian fluid over a vertical cone embedded in a porous medium in the presence of heat generation are studied. By using similarity transformations, the governing equations describing the problem are transformed to a system of nonlinear ordinary differential equations, which are solved numerically. The results are presented in the graphical form. The effects of various physical parameters and of the local Nusselt number on the velocity and the temperature profiles are discussed.
